The Intern - Recovery Support Specialist is a live-in transitional role assigned to residents progressing through the later phase of the Substance Use Disorder (SUD) program. Interns serve as peer mentors and contribute to the structure, safety, and daily functioning of the residential environment. The role is a non-clinical, focused on peer engagement, life-skills reinforcement, role-modeling, and support of the daily milieu. Interns assist staff in promoting a recovery-oriented environment while demonstrating leadership, stability, and accountability.
